Comments on "Robust optimal design and convergence properties analysis of iterative learning control approaches" and "On the P-type and Newton-type ILC schemes for dynamic systems with non-affine input factors"

R Schmid

Automatica | PERGAMON-ELSEVIER SCIENCE LTD | Published : 2007

Abstract

The papers by Xu and Tan [Robust optimal design and convergence properties analysis of iterative learning control approaches, Automatica 38 (2002) 1867-1880], and Xu and Tan [On the P-type and Newton-type ILC schemes for dynamic systems with non-affine input factors, Automatica 38 (2002) 1237-1242], give a convergence analysis for several iterative learning control approaches. Unfortunately, these papers contains several mathematical errors that render the proofs of the claimed results invalid. As there are no obvious ways to correct these errors, the results presented in these papers are questionable. © 2007 Elsevier Ltd. All rights reserved.
